Meaning & usage

noun/ˈdræɡᵊnˈɔɪd/UK/ˈdræɡənɔɪd/US
  1. A dragon-like creature of various kinds.

  2. A hypervalent organosilicon compound that features a five-membered coordination heterocycle incorporating a trifluorosilicon moiety (F₃Si–) and an internal Si←O coordination bond.

Where this word comes from

From dragon + -oid.
